Overview of Cloud Backup Software Market

The cloud backup software market encompasses solutions designed to securely store, manage, and recover data via cloud infrastructure. These core products include automated backup services, hybrid cloud solutions, and enterprise-grade data protection platforms that facilitate seamless data replication and disaster recovery. The primary end-use industries span across IT and telecommunications, healthcare, BFSI (banking, financial services, and insurance), government, and retail, all of which rely heavily on robust data management strategies.

In the global economy, cloud backup software is a critical enabler of digital resilience, supporting business continuity and regulatory compliance. As organizations increasingly migrate their workloads to the cloud, the demand for scalable, secure, and cost-effective backup solutions continues to surge. The market’s importance is underscored by the exponential growth of data volumes, rising cyber threats, and the need for rapid recovery capabilities, making cloud backup an indispensable component of modern IT infrastructure.

Cloud Backup Software Market Drivers

Growing data volumes across industries are a primary driver, compelling organizations to adopt cloud backup solutions for scalable and reliable data protection. The acceleration of digital transformation initiatives, including automation and cloud-first strategies, further fuels market expansion. Governments worldwide are implementing policies that promote cloud adoption, data security, and compliance, creating a conducive environment for market growth.

Additionally, the proliferation of remote work and BYOD (Bring Your Own Device) policies increase the need for secure, accessible backup solutions. The rising frequency and sophistication of cyberattacks, such as ransomware, also compel organizations to invest in robust backup and disaster recovery solutions. As cloud technology becomes more cost-effective and user-friendly, adoption rates are expected to accelerate, supporting sustained industry growth.

Cloud Backup Software Market Restraints

High implementation and subscription costs pose significant barriers, especially for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). Regulatory hurdles, including complex compliance requirements across different jurisdictions, can delay deployment and increase operational complexity. Supply chain disruptions, particularly in hardware components and cloud infrastructure, may impact service availability and scalability.

Market saturation in mature regions presents another restraint, limiting growth opportunities for new entrants. Additionally, concerns over data security, privacy, and vendor lock-in can hinder adoption, particularly among highly regulated industries. These factors collectively temper the rapid expansion of the cloud backup software market and necessitate strategic mitigation by providers.

Cloud Backup Software Market Segmentation Analysis

By Type, the market segments into standalone backup solutions, integrated cloud data management platforms, and hybrid backup services. The fastest-growing segment is hybrid backup solutions, driven by the need for flexible, scalable, and cost-efficient data protection that combines on-premises and cloud environments.

In terms of Application, the primary sectors include enterprise IT, healthcare, BFSI, government, and retail. The enterprise IT segment remains dominant, but healthcare and BFSI are rapidly expanding due to stringent compliance and data security requirements. Geographically, North America leads, followed by Europe, with APAC experiencing the highest growth rate, especially in emerging economies. The Asia-Pacific region is expected to see the fastest growth, propelled by increasing cloud infrastructure investments and digital transformation initiatives.
